KRF-V8080D/V8080D-S/VR-8050
ACCESSORIES / CAUTIONS
Accessories
FM indoor antenna (1) (T90-0877-05): EE1 (T90-0905-05): KP AM loop antenna (1) (T90-0893-05) Remote control unit (1) RC-R0823 (A70-1623-05): EE1 RC-R0822 (A70-1622-05): KP Batteries (R6/AA) (2)
Color vs Model
Model KRF-V8080D KRF-V8080D-S VR-8050 Color Black Silver Black ABB. E E1 KP
Cautions
Resetting the Microcomputer
The microcomputer may malfunction (unit cannot be operated, or shows an erroneous display) if the power cord is unplugged while the power is ON, or due to some other external factor. If this happens, execute the following procedure to rese � Please note that resetting the microcomputer will clear the contents of the memory and return the unit to the state it was in when it left the factory.
For the U.S.A. and Canada
Unplug the power cord from the wall outlet, then plug it back in while holding down the POWER ON/STANDBY key.
For other countries
With the power cord plugged in, turn the POWER ON/OFF key OFF. Then, while holding down the ON/STANDBY key, press POWER ON/OFF key.
Memory back up function
Please note that the following items will be deleted from the unit�s memory if the power cord is disconnected from the AC outlet for approximately 1 day. � Power mode � Input selector settings � Picture output � Speaker ON/OFF � Volume level � BASS, TREBLE, INPUT level � TONE ON/OFF � LOUDNESS ON/OFF � Dimmer level � MD/TAPE settings � Listen mode setting � Speaker settings � Distance setting � Input mode setting �Sound mode settings � Broadcast band � Frequency setting � Preset stations � Tuning mode � ACTIVE EQ mode � SPEAKER EQ mode
